Denver--Governor John Hickenlooper is asking Colorado residents to observe a moment of silence this Friday to remember the 26 people killed at Sandy Hook Elementary School.

According to state officials, Hickenlooper and governors across the country are calling for the moment of silence at 9:30 a.m. local time, the same hour the shooting happened last Friday in Connecticut.

Hickenlooper is also urging government buildings and places of worship to ring bells 26 times, to remember the victims killed in the tragedy.
